Transaction 121db954eef9fb10c5cf9b91c57c23936c9bf845fad71f94ffba004ac1560e6c

1 Input
1 Outputs
  • 121db954eef9fb10c5cf9b91c57c23936c9bf845fad71f94ffba004ac1560e6c:0
  • value  1409259
    address  3E4y4c4sA5fEE9d6BCEvphSM1yvNSmtbGv